Transaction 7891cf369457932077cdbbc719d56f22949b7bb65455970ff2e8de7feaafdf5e

2 Input
2 Outputs
  • 7891cf369457932077cdbbc719d56f22949b7bb65455970ff2e8de7feaafdf5e:0
  • value  19216255
    address  3HzH1ecZjvvKWL5Tfsn9ngBsUpV7dtW6WB
  • 7891cf369457932077cdbbc719d56f22949b7bb65455970ff2e8de7feaafdf5e:1
  • value  255644562
    address  3HN87mwNy617p3JfZqz1s4wrhKsKLCeR1v